Fwd: ShEx validation for FHIR RDF Playground

In case someone can pick up where Houcemeddine left off . . .

------- Forwarded Message --------
Subject:  RE: ShEx validation for FHIR RDF Playground
Date:  Sat, 9 Sep 2023 17:54:15 +0000
From:  Houcemeddine A. Turki <turkiabdelwaheb@hotmail.fr>
To:  David Booth <david@dbooth.org>
CC:  Eric Prud'hommeaux <eric@uu3.org>, Champion, James Robert 
<champioj@email.unc.edu>

Dear Sir,
I thank you for your answer. Of course, please feel free to share it.
Yours Sincerely,
Houcemeddine Turki
------------------------------------------------------------------------
*De :* David Booth <david@dbooth.org>
*Envoyé :* samedi 9 septembre 2023 18:48
*À :* Houcemeddine A. Turki <turkiabdelwaheb@hotmail.fr>
*Cc :* Eric Prud'hommeaux <eric@uu3.org>; Champion, James Robert 
<champioj@email.unc.edu>
*Objet :* Re: ShEx validation for FHIR RDF Playground
Hi Houcemeddine,

Thanks very much for your efforts, and for explaining where you left
off.  It was nice to have your participation and contributions, and I
hope medical school goes well.

Could I have your permission to post your message (below) on the public
email list, so that we have a public record of where you left off, in
case someone else can continue the work?

Thanks,
David Booth

On 9/9/23 05:58, Houcemeddine A. Turki wrote:
> Dear all,
> I thank you for your efforts. After a few days of work, I think that the 
> work requires someone who is more experienced than me in JavaScript. The 
> most difficult work was to add the ShEx Validator to the Playground. 
> When seeing the Console, it seems that the ShEx validation JavaScript is 
> loaded as shown in Fig1.png as attached to this email. What remains to 
> do is to add the Function to the Playground, I tried to 
> add globalThis.ShExValidator = require('@shexjs/validator'); to 
> Playground/fhircat-addons.js as shown at Line 13 of 
> https://github.com/csisc/fhir-rdf-playground/blob/main/playground/fhircat-addons.js 
<https://github.com/csisc/fhir-rdf-playground/blob/main/playground/fhircat-addons.js> 
<https://github.com/csisc/fhir-rdf-playground/blob/main/playground/fhircat-addons.js 
<https://github.com/csisc/fhir-rdf-playground/blob/main/playground/fhircat-addons.js>>. 
However, fhircat-addons.js is not updated when I run my fork of the FHIR 
RDF Playground. Another problem is the source code of the Validation 
does not work for a reason. Please find attached the latest edition of 
my source code. Currently, what should be done is unfortunately beyond 
what I can do. I could do it if I had more time. But, I have to save 
time for medical school. I am sorry for dropping out. Please write me 
back if there is anything that needs to be explained about what I did. I 
will answer emails as I can no longer attend the meetings. Have a nice day.
> Yours Sincerely,
> Houcemeddine Turki

Received on Saturday, 9 September 2023 18:35:49 UTC